Strength Beneath the Waves: $18.4B to Build SSN 812, SSN 813 and Bolster U.S. Shipyards

General Dynamics Electric Boat Corp., Groton, Connecticut (N00024-12-C-2115, N00024-17-C-2100, N00024-17-C-2117); and Huntington Ingalls Inc., Newport News Shipbuilding, Newport News, Virginia (N00024-15-C-2114, N00024-16-C-2116, and N00024-21-C-2106), are awarded cost-plus-incentive-fee with ceilings, and cost-plus-fixed-fee contract modifications for construction of two fiscal 2024 Virginia-class submarines (SSN 812 and SSN 813), investments to improve productivity at the shipyards, and for nuclear-powered vessel programs workforce support and investment. General Dynamics Electric Boat Corp. is being awarded $12,418,145,463, and if all options are exercised the total value will be $17,152,265,971; and Huntington Ingalls Inc., Newport News Shipbuilding, is being awarded $1,293,694,000. These contracts include options which, if exercised, would bring the cumulative value of the contract change to $18,445,959,971. The awarded amounts include previously announced material awards (including long lead time material and economic ordering quantity material) totaling $2,103,896,000. Work will be performed in Groton, Connecticut (32%); Newport News, Virginia (32%); Quonset Point, Rhode Island (8%); Sunnyvale, California (4%); Goose Creek, South Carolina (2%); Mobile, Alabama (1%); Sykesville, Maryland (1%); Bethlehem, Pennsylvania (1%); and other locations less than 1% (19%), and is expected to be completed by June 2036. Fiscal 2024 shipbuilding and conversion (Navy) funding in the amount of $5,263,038,425; and fiscal 2025 shipbuilding and conversion (Navy) funding in the amount of $4,163,000,000, will be obligated at time of award and will not expire at the end of the current fiscal year. Naval Sea Systems Command, Washington, D.C., is the contracting activity.
